Background technology:
Food engineering is grain, Oil processing, the general name of the field of engineering technology such as food manufacturing and drink manufacturing.
The evolution of food engineering and the history of food production industry are long equally, it is possible to trace back to fermentation in ancient times and evaporation process.Historically, the appearance of food processing is early far beyond chemical process.Historical continuity that the mankind process food with home cooking and manual mode many centuries, but the appearance of food industry is only then the thing of last 100 years.For a long time, food industry is the form with workshop, is its production basis with traditional method by rule of thumb.In 19 end of the centurys, the principles of science just initially enters food processing field.The scientific importance of food processing is introduced into and uses chemical engineering unit operation, concurrent spread to become food engineering unit to operate, thus having promoted that food industry develops towards the direction of extensive, serialization and automatization.
The unit operation that food engineering is studied generally comprises: material conveying, cleaning, classification, broken, separations, mixing, emulsifying, heat transfer, concentration, dry, freeze, vacuumizing and packaging.Food manufacturing processes is generally made up of several unit operation processes therein.Major part unit process is that the philosophy flowed by mass transfer, heat transfer and fluid determines.The essence of these processes had both comprised the transmission of heat, comprised again the transmission of quality, and the key that decision process carries out is then heat transmission.

Detailed description of the invention:
For making the purpose of this utility model, technical scheme and advantage clearly understand, below by the specific embodiment shown in accompanying drawing, this utility model is described.However, it should be understood that these descriptions are illustrative of, and it is not intended to limit scope of the present utility model.Additionally, in the following description, eliminate the description to known features and technology, to avoid unnecessarily obscuring concept of the present utility model.
As it is shown in figure 1, this detailed description of the invention is by the following technical solutions: it comprises casing 1, muff 2, stirring motor 3, main shaft 4, stirring rod 5, paddle 6, the plate 7 that gathers materials, heat block 8, tremie pipe 9, baiting valve 10, stirring wind wheel 11, blanking wheel 12;The bottom of casing 1 is provided with muff 2, the upper end of casing 1 is provided with stirring motor 3, the axle of stirring motor 3 is connected with main shaft 4, the outer surface of main shaft 4 is provided with several stirring rod 5, the upper end of stirring rod 5 is provided with several paddle 6, the lower end of casing 1 is provided with the plate 7 that gathers materials, the gather materials middle part of plate 7 is provided with tremie pipe 9, tremie pipe 9 is provided with baiting valve 10, the upper end of tremie pipe 9 is provided with blanking wheel 2, the gather materials bottom of plate 7 is provided with heat block 8, and two stirring wind wheels 11 are separately positioned on the upside of the plate 7 that gathers materials.
Further, described baiting valve 10 is electrodynamic type baiting valve.
Further, described stirring motor 3 is speed governing type stirring motor.
The operation principle of this detailed description of the invention is: realize quick stirring by stirring motor 3, stirring rod 5, paddle 6 realize quick stirring simultaneously, stirring wind wheel 11 improves stirring efficiency, heat block 8 realizes quick heating, muff 2 realizes insulation, during blanking, opens blanking wheel 12, blanking wheel realizes stirring and blanking, opens baiting valve 10 and realizes fast blanking.
